 .pagetop {background-color:#008452}
 .pagetop TD:nth-child(2) {font: normal 120% capriola ; color:#FFC;
                           text-shadow: 2px 2px 0 #000}

  BODY {font-size:110%; background-color:#FFFFFC; color:#000}
  A:link {color:#039; text-decoration: none}
  A:visited {color:#039; text-decoration: none}
  HR {color:#063}
  VAR {font: bold italic 90% arial,sans-serif; color:#444}
  EM {font: bold italic 90% arial; color:#375}       /*633*/
  Q {color:#FFF}                                     /* hide the anti-search char (.) */ 
  Q IMG {float:left; width:.8em; padding-right:2px}  /* for smaller inline icons */
   
 .search {font: normal 100% verdana,sans-serif; color:#639}
 .region {font: normal 140% capriola,verdana; color:#A03; text-align: center}
 .area {font: bold 110% varela round,verdana; color:#525; margin-left: 0em}
 .initiate {font: italic 110% verdana,sans-serif; color:#639}

 .hike, .fire, .closed, .broken {font-weight:bold; color:#03C; white-space:pre;
                                 margin-top:-.5em; margin-left:1.5em;}
 .icon IMG {float:left; width:1.2em; padding-right:6px}   /* used in instructions */ 

  TABLE.firemsg {font-style: normal; border:1px solid black; box-shadow:4px 4px #669; 
   margin-top:1em; padding:.2em .4em .2em .2em; color:#009; background-color:#FCA} 
 .firemsg IMG {width:40px; padding-right:.3em; vertical-align: middle}   
 

 
 